The owner must:
- Be a company registered in Ireland or an Irish resident or citizen; or
- Be a company or individual who can prove a link to Ireland.
Important: You can prove a link to Ireland by:
- Providing evidence to show that you are either currently trading with or providing a service to Irish customers (e.g. invoices, high quality marketing material aimed at the Irish market, or a solicitor or accountant’s letter confirming your current or future trade with Ireland).
- Providing evidence to show that they will be relocating to Ireland in the near future.
- Holding a Republic of Ireland, Northern Ireland or EU Community registered trademark.
If you have an Irish Trademark, an EU Community Trademark, or a WIPO Trademark enforceable in Ireland, please just send your trademark number or certificate.
If you do not, please submit JUST ONE of the following:
- Certificate of Incorporation
- Verifiable online company number
- VAT number
- Proof of being registered for Income Tax
- Trademark number or certificate
And JUST ONE of the following:
Sales invoices showing that the domain holder sells goods or services in the island of Ireland
Signed letter from a third-party solicitor, accountant, bank manager or auditor, confirming that the domain holder is selling goods or services in the island of Ireland
